Gor Mahia prove too good for Sony Sugar at Moi Stadium while drama ensues at Afraha as Tusker save their game against Ulinzi Stars with an equalizer in time added on in the second half on Saturday.

Sony Sugar 1-2 Gor Mahia (Moi Stadium)

Burly midfielder Ernest Wendo sent Gor Mahia ahead in the 21st minute, breaking loose in the middle and firing a stern shot past the stationary Sony Sugar custodian Kelvin Otieno.

The sugar millers replied 10 minutes later when January acquisition George Abege beat Boniface Oluoch with his effort.

Rwandan Meddie Kagere, who scored in K’Ogalo’s 1-0 win over Kakamega Homeboyz last weekend, was at it again, coming off the bench to restore the visitor’s lead four minutes after the restart.

Tusker 1-1 Ulinzi Stars (Afraha Stadium)

Veteran striker Stephen Waruru scored in the 77th minute to put Ulinzi ahead as he recorded his first goal of the season, connecting well with Daniel Waweru’s cross.

The soldiers looked to have done enough only for Tusker’s new signing Hassan Abdalla to grab a late, late winner.
